Role Summary

Join the ADI global modeling team to develop and validate compact device models for high-voltage LDMOS, CMOS and related devices. The role combines device-physics research, hands-on electrical characterization, and compact-model development to support advanced process development.

Responsibilities

Key responsibilities include building and validating compact device models and performing device characterization:

  • Develop compact models for LDMOS, CMOS, BJT, diode, resistor, and capacitor devices, with emphasis on high-voltage devices.
  • Characterize and model inter-device parasitics, including parasitic bipolar transistor action and cross-coupling effects.
  • Perform electrical measurements and instrument evaluation; identify limitations and improve measurement methods.
  • Address multi-physics modeling needs (electrical, thermal, mechanical) where relevant.
  • Model long-term device degradation for MOS and LDMOS technologies.
  • Collaborate with global modeling teams across locations and produce technical reports and documentation.

About the Company

Company: Analog Devices

Headquarters: Norwood, Massachusetts, USA

Analog Devices is a leading global semiconductor company that bridges the physical and digital worlds, enabling breakthroughs at the Intelligent Edge. With a focus on innovation, ADI develops solutions that drive advancements in digitized factories, mobility, and digital healthcare. The company employs around 24,000 people globally and reported revenues exceeding $9 billion in FY24, creating technologies that transform lives across various sectors.
